Oh and whoever the hell thought up that stupid allen bolt on the nose of the K18 ought to have been taken outside and shot.
Huge mass right where it would do the most damage, high compliance undamped cantilever, heavy metal body.
Fit this in the medium mass Akito and it was a sure fire recipe for instability, mistracking and cone flap.
But the thing was ultra rigid so that was alright then. That was all that mattered.
Utter but I had no idea at the time.
The irony is that the K18 would probably have worked like a charm in an SME III

Late 90s, pro-ject had just started, i got a project 9c arm through moorgate acoustics (even though they werent supposed to sell them separately, they acquired one for me)
That very same fruitbox was gotten out from under the bed where it had lain for at least 10 years. The piece of crap akito was removed, the project arm was fitted, wired to a tag strip as it was bare wired with no output cable ( as it wasnt on general sale) so no fucking stupid massively stiff arm cable to dress and completely balls up the suspension.
An ortofon 540 mm cart was fitted.
And do you know what?
The bloody thing worked. Well.
Fast forward ten years and linn offered the same combo that I stumbled onto by complete accident as the basik.
The lp12 is not entirely crap, but it is entirely too much money, then and now.
It is flawed, there are ways to compensate some for the flaws. Would I buy one now? No. But it can make a reasonable noise if that is your thing
